Abstract

The invention relates to an electrode collecting EEG signals; the electrode comprises an electrode body; the electrode body is hollow, and the internal diameter of the upper cavity of the hollow portion is bigger than that of the lower cavity of the hollow portion; the periphery on top of the electrode body is provided with a groove; the periphery of a conductive liquid sinking storage device is provided with a conductive liquid sinking storage device cover; the conductive liquid sinking storage device cover is fixed on the groove through a O-shape ring; the periphery on the bottom of the electrode body is provided with a wire slot; a wire is welded in the wire slot; an electrode shield is arranged outside the electrode body; the bottom of the electrode shield is provided with a through hole, wherein the internal diameter of the through hole is same with that of the lower cavity of the hollow portion; the electrode shield and electrode body are fixed by a fixing device; the side edge on the bottom of the electrode shield is provided with a wire hole allowing the wire to pass; the conductive liquid sinking storage device cover is slightly higher than the top edge of the electrode shield. The electrode structure can be improved so as to directly pour conductive liquid into the conductive liquid sinking storage device, thus eliminating discomfort caused by a conventional dry type electrode invading the scalp, and eliminating discomfort caused by a wet type electrode pasted on the patient scalp.

Background technology
Brain electrical acti is the summation of the postsynaptic potential of cerebral cortex pyramidal cell and its vertical dendron, and play regulatory role to complete by the non-specific core at thalamus center line position.The current potential of neuron is the basis of the physiological activity of central nervous system, therefore can reflect the change of its function and pathology.By accurate electronic machine, a kind of method potential change of brain amplified and recorded from scalp, i.e. electroencephalogram, it is the method for monitoring brain function most sensitive at present.
With the development of Neurology Department in recent years, the use of electroencephalogram is also more and more universal.At present, gathering the conventional electrode of EEG signals has wet type electrode and dry-type electrode.
1st, wet type electrode is referred to.Because having skin penetrant and conductive materials inside pasty electrode cream, the impedance for so reducing skin makes the EEG signals for measuring truer, sensitive.But, when doctor uses pasty state conductive paste, need to be expelled in electrode one by one, can so waste medical worker's time, while pasty state conductive paste can allow patient uncomfortable, check that the cleaning for terminating is also pretty troublesome.2nd, dry-type electrode refers to that acquisition electrode is directly contacted with scalp when EEG signals are gathered.Classical dry-type electrode makes needle-like array, reduces Skin Resistance with press-in or minimally invasive skin method.As acquisition electrode is heavy metal, press-in or the mode for invading can bring pain to patient, and being pierced into horny layer easily makes heavy metal enter skin and blood, causes heavy metal poisoning.If dry-type electrode does not invade skin, because Skin Resistance is higher, the data accuracy of test can be poor.
The drawbacks of both the above electrode has certain.
On the other hand, current electrode cap is commonly weaving face fabric, and first, electrode cap is extremely inconvenient in sewing;Add, electrode cap is difficult to do after being stained with conductive liquid or electrode cream or cleaning, could use after needing to wait weaving face fabric dry, can so affect the efficiency for detecting.3rd, current electrode cap is all cover, is easily perspired during summer patient worn.4th, soaked in a liquid, after taking-up, need a very long time could airing, and after waiting electrode cap to dry, the conductive liquid inside electrode also can part it is impacted.
